    Default Brake Pad Options

    Hey guys,

    As my BR330 Evo VIII sits now it has brand new slotted rotors all around with Hawk ceramic brake pads all around also. The current pads are starting to get to the point where they need replacing. So the plans for the car right now in the near future are to build it to be a mid to low 11 second car. I probably won't be tracking it much at all in the next few seasons till I get more of it paid off. So I don't need super heavy duty pads, but I also don't want some weak s*** either. I do like the current Hawk pads for the fact they emit hardly any brake dust and arent actually THAT loud/squeeky. Just curious if you guys recommended any particular types of brake pads...I'd be interested to hear your input. Thanks!
